However, proficient methods to detect A\u03b2-oligomers in brain tissue are lacking. Here we show that synthetic M13 bacteriophages displaying A\u03b2-derived peptides on their surface preferentially interact with A\u03b2-oligomers. When exposed to brain tissue isolated from APP\/PS1-transgenic mice, these bacteriophages detect small-sized A\u03b2-aggregates in hippocampus at an early age, prior to the occurrence of A\u03b2-plaques. Similarly, the bacteriophages reveal the presence of such small A\u03b2-aggregates in <jats:italic>post-mortem<\/jats:italic> hippocampus tissue of AD-patients.
